What are the Possible Causes of the DTC P0014 Jeep?

NOTE: The causes shown may not be a complete list of all potential problems, and it is possible that there may be other causes.
  • Engine oil dirty or contaminated
  • Incorrect engine oil viscosity
  • Faulty Variable Cam Timing (VCT) solenoid
  • Variable Cam Timing solenoid circuit is open or shorted
  • Variable Cam Timing solenoid circuit poor electrical connection
  • Faulty Powertrain Control Module (PCM)

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

The cost to diagnose the P0014 Jeep code is 1.0 hour of labor. The di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ops vary depending on the location, make and model of the vehicle, and even the engine type. Most auto repair shops charge between $75 and $150 per hour.

What Does the P0014 Jeep Code Mean?

Variable Cam Timing (VCT) allows the Powertrain Control Module (PCM) to monitor and adjust the position of the camshaft, based on desired torque levels and engine operating conditions. The camshaft design allows for the exhaust lobes to be adjusted while the intake lobes are not adjustable all on one camshaft. The PCM controls a solenoid operated control valve, which is used to direct oil pressure to a hydraulic actuator mounted between the camshaft and its driving sprocket. The oil pressure alters the angular position or phasing of the camshaft relative to crankshaft rotation. A sensor is used to monitor the position of the camshaft.
The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) will set when the actual camshaft phasing position is not moving towards the desired camshaft phasing position during steady-state operation.
